Country Differences in Older Men’s Hearing Difficulty Disadvantage DOI
Shane D. Burns, Jessica West

Journal of Aging and Health, Год журнала: 2024, Номер unknown

Опубликована: Май 6, 2024

Objectives: Hearing difficulty is prevalent in older adulthood and projected to increase via global aging, particularly among men. Currently, there limited research on how this gender disparity might vary by country. Methods: Using 2018 data ( n = 29,480) from the Health Retirement Study (HRS) international family of studies, we investigate disparities hearing respondents ages 55–89 United States 12,566), Mexico 10,762), Korea 6152) with country-specific ordinal logistic regression models that progressively adjust for demographic, social, health indicators. Results: In States, men’s disadvantage was consistently observed. Mexico, explained interactive effect age group but resurfaced after adjusting comorbidities. Korea, no difference difficulty. Discussion: Our results highlight heterogeneity a diverse aging countries.
